Partnership Grants Unmatched Access

PROVO, Utah—The unique partnership of BYU Athletics and BYUtv teams up this week to bring Cougar Nation unprecedented access to BYU sports.

Starting off the week, Cougar Nation can watch women’s soccer take on Idaho at 7 p.m. Tuesday. The game will also be streamed on BYUtv.org.

Thursday, Jimmermania returns to Provo with Jimmer’s All-Stars Presented by Zions Bank, featuring former Cougars Jimmer Fredette and Jackson Emery as well as Kemba Walker, Kawhi Leonard and five more first-round NBA draft picks. BYUtv will broadcast the game live from the Marriott Center at 7 p.m.

At 10 p.m., BYUtv will air the women’s volleyball league-opener against Saint Mary’s. Volleyball fans can still watch the 7 p.m. match live with live online streaming through BYUtv.org.

Soccer also plays at 7 p.m. Thursday, going up against in-state foe Utah State. Fans can listen to the game on BYU Radio.

Friday, the BYUtv crew previews the football team’s second home game of the season against Central Florida with the Countdown to Kick Off Pregame Show at 6 p.m. and follow up with the Post-Game Show. Fans can listen to the game on BYU Radio. BYUtv will rebroadcast the game at 10 p.m.
